Container Oasis

🌱 Utilizing in Container Design

Ficus sinuata thrives beautifully in decorative pots, making it a fantastic choice for container gardening. Group these plants with complementary species to create a vibrant display that catches the eye.

πŸͺ΄ Choosing the Right Containers

Opt for large containers, ideally 18-24 inches in diameter, to allow ample root growth. This size ensures your Ficus has enough space to flourish, leading to lush, healthy foliage.

🎨 Aesthetic Appeal

The rich green leaves of Ficus sinuata contrast strikingly with various pot materials, from ceramic to metal. This versatility allows you to match your containers with your overall garden theme or patio decor.

🌞 Perfect for Patios

These plants are ideal for patios, where they can add a touch of nature to your outdoor space. For smaller areas, consider using smaller pots or even hanging arrangements to maximize your greenery without overwhelming the space.

πŸ“ Practical Tips

  • Group Plants: Combine Ficus with other plants that have similar care needs.
  • Consider Height: Vary the heights of your containers to create visual interest.
  • Seasonal Changes: Swap out seasonal flowers for a fresh look throughout the year.

Layered Landscapes

🎨 Techniques for Depth

Creating a layered landscape with Ficus sinuata adds visual intrigue to your garden. Position taller plants at the back and shorter ones in the front to establish a natural flow.

🌿 Companion Plant Choices

Consider pairing Ficus sinuata with tropical plants like hibiscus or ornamental grasses. These companions not only thrive in similar conditions but also enhance the overall aesthetic.

🌈 Benefits of Layering

Layered designs bring depth and interest, especially in backyards. They create a dynamic environment that invites exploration and appreciation.

🌱 Planting Strategy

When selecting companion plants, ensure they share similar light and water needs. This harmony will keep your garden thriving and visually cohesive.

Pathway Accents

Enhancing Pathways 🌿

Transform your pathways by lining them with Ficus sinuata. This not only guides visitors but also adds a touch of elegance to your landscape.

Spacing and Height Variation πŸ“

Space the plants evenly along the path for a cohesive look. Varying heights creates visual interest, making the journey more inviting.

Softening Hardscapes 🌸

The lush form of Ficus sinuata softens hardscapes, providing a gentle transition between different areas of your garden. This approach enhances the overall aesthetic and invites exploration.

Choosing the Right Size πŸ“

For narrow pathways, opt for smaller specimens to maintain flow. In contrast, group larger plants for wider paths to create a more dramatic effect.
